The coat is matted but I wanted a specific style.
Usually not, and it is better to hear that now. A tight mat has to come off, which means clipping under it at whatever length the mat allows. The haircut you wanted becomes possible again once the coat has grown back healthy.

What if the coat turns out worse than I described?
We stop and talk to you before continuing. You get told what we found, what it now costs in time, and what the realistic result is. Nobody benefits from us pressing on and presenting a surprise at the end.
Is there a charge for de-matting?
Where it adds real time, yes, and you hear the figure before it starts. De-matting is slow, careful work and it is uncomfortable for the dog, which is why we will often recommend clipping the mat off instead as the kinder and cheaper option.
How do you decide the clipper length?
From the coat, the season, the dog's lifestyle, and what you want, in roughly that order. A dog that swims or runs through undergrowth is better shorter. We will name the length rather than saying a vague amount.
Will a shave-down ruin the coat?
On a single-coated breed, no, it grows back as it was. On a double-coated breed it can grow back patchy with the undercoat coming through faster than the guard hairs, and it may never sit right again. That is why we push back on shaving those.
